CentOS5.5 下配置DNS

1.配置網卡IP地址

#ifconfig   eth0   192.168.186.188


2.關閉防火牆

#iptables -F


3.安裝軟件   

所需要的軟件:bind和caching-name

#rpm  -ivh  bind-9.3.6-4.P1.el5

#rpm  -ivh  caching-nameserver-9.3.6-4.P1.el5


4.修改named.conf 配置文件

修改named.caching-nameserver.conf

#cp /etc/named.caching-nameserver.conf  /etc/named.conf 

#vi /etc/named.conf

將所有的localhoat都修改爲any


5.修改區域文件

vi  /etc/named.rfc1912.zones 


zone "huanjie.com" IN {

        type master;

        file "huanjie.com.hosts";

        allow-update { none; };

};

zone "22.64.10.in-addr.arpa" IN {

        type master;

        file "huanjie.com.rev";

        allow-update { none; };

};


6.建立正向配置文件

#cd /usr/share/doc/bind-9.7.0/sample/var/named

#cp  -p   named.localhost    /var/named/

#cd /var/named

#cp   named.localhost   huanjie.com.hosts

#vi  huanjie.com.hosts

內容如下:

$TTL 1D

@       IN SOA  @ rname.invalid. (

                                        0       ; serial

                                        1D      ; refresh

                                        1H      ; retry

                                        1W      ; expire

                                        3H )    ; minimum

               NS       server2.huanjie.com.

server2        IN   A   192.168.186.188

www            IN   A   192.168.186.188

ftp            IN   A   192.168.186.188


7.建立反向配置文件

#cp   huanjie.com.hosts   huanjie.com.rev

#vi   huanjie.com.rev

  

$TTL 1D

@       IN SOA  @ rname.invalid. (

                                        0       ; serial

                                        1D      ; refresh

                                        1H      ; retry

                                        1W      ; expire

                                        3H )    ; minimum

        NS      server2.huanjie.com.


188  IN  PTR   server2.huanjie.com.

188  IN  PTR   www.huanjie.com.

188  IN  PTR   ftp.huanjie.com.


8.更改所有者(很多學習者容易忽略的地方,請注意)

#cd /var/named

#chown named:named  huanjie.com.hosts

#chown named:named  huanjie.com.rev


9.啓動DNS服務

#service  named restart


10.更改dns服務器IP爲本地

#vi /etc/resolv.conf

servername=192.168.186.188


11.測試是否成功

#nslookup   server2.huanjie.com

#nslookup   192.168.186.188


注意事項:

1.named-checkconf   配置文件路徑     -------檢測配置文件是否有語法錯誤 

  如:named-checkconf   /var/named/chroot/named.conf

2.named-checkzone   域名  區域文件路徑    -------檢測區域文見是否有語法錯誤

  如:named-checkzone    huanjie.com   /var/named/chroot/named.conf

3.如果重啓速度慢,則可以使用rndc reload 快速加載


發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章